Evaluation of the performance of a centralized ground-water heat pump system in cold climate region

Shilei LU,Zhe CAI,Li ZHANG,Yiran LI

Frontiers in Energy 2014, Volume 8, Issue 3,   Pages 394-402 doi: 10.1007/s11708-014-0310-1

Abstract: The aim of this study is to evaluate the performance of a centralized open-loop ground-water heat pump(GWHP) system for climate conditioning in Beijing with a cold climate in China.Thus, a long-time test was conducted on a running GWHP system for the heating season from December 2011The analysis of the testing data indicates that the average heat-pump coefficient of performance (COP) and the COP of the system (COPs) are 4.27 and 2.59.
